How Do Cleanroom Workstations Support Contamination Control?

Maintaining cleanliness is one of the biggest challenges in controlled environments. Even small particles or contaminants can affect product quality in sensitive applications. Cleanroom workstations are designed to support contamination prevention by offering surfaces and structures that are easy to clean and maintain.

Many workstations are built with durable materials that resist corrosion, chemical exposure, and particle accumulation. Their smooth designs reduce areas where contaminants can collect, making routine cleaning easier and more effective.

Why Are Ergonomic Designs Important for Workflow Performance?

Employee comfort directly affects productivity. When operators work for long periods in uncomfortable positions, fatigue can reduce concentration and increase the possibility of errors. Cleanroom workstations with ergonomic features help you create a safer and more efficient working environment.

Adjustable heights, accessible storage options, and practical layouts allow workers to perform tasks comfortably. Improved ergonomics reduces physical strain and helps maintain consistent performance throughout long work periods.

A workstation designed around human movement also supports faster task completion. When employees can access materials easily and work in comfortable positions, they can maintain higher productivity levels without compromising accuracy.
